NIST Provides Confidential Information

 

Purpose

 
    The Non-disclosure Agreement for disclosure of NIST's proprietary information is used when NIST personnel are disclosing information that is patentable subject matter upon which NIST may file for a patent. This Non-disclosure Agreement preserves NIST's ability to pursue patent protection. It also defines the treatment of the information by the recipient organization under terms acceptable to both NIST and the recipient.
         
  Procedure  
   

If a NIST employee and an outside party feel that it is necessary for NIST proprietary information to be disclosed, the NIST employee must obtain the approval of his/her management. To do so, he/she obtains a copy of the "Non Disclosure Agreement for Dislcosure of NIST's Proprietary Information" from the Office of Technology Partnerships and forwards it, along with other relevant information, through his/her management chain for review and approval. If approved, copies of the Agreement are signed by both parties.
